State Rep. Janet Long endorses Scott Wagman for St. Petersburg mayor

Scott Wagman continues to lock up endorsements from elected Democrats. On Thursday he added state Rep. Janet Long to state Rep. Bill Heller, state Sen. Charlie Justice and Pinellas School Board member Linda Lerner.

From a release:

“After taking the time to get to know Scott, I believe that he has the unique skills to lead this city through a difficult budget crisis and the drive to make our streets safer, our jobs more secure, and St. Petersburg a desirable place for any young family to raise their children,” Long said. “I believe the voters of St. Petersburg are hungry for new leadership and not politics as usual and I agree with them. I think it is time for some out-of-the-box thinking and a new type of executive experience to lead St. Petersburg into the future. I believe Scott Wagman possesses those qualities and will bring a fresh new approach to running our city."

The other leading Dems running for mayor are Jamie Bennett and Kathleen Ford (Of course, it should be noted that the mayor's race is nonpartisan).
